Stanage Pole
Landmark
👍 Stanage Pole is a landmark on Hallam Moors near to Stanage Edge. At 438 metres (1,437 feet) height, it marks the border between Derbyshire and South Yorkshire and can be seen for several miles around. Apparently a pole has stood on the site since at least 1550.
